Deadly Inaccurate by Jennifer Roback Morse

Deadly Inaccurate

The Party of Death: The Democrats, the Media, the Courts, and the Disregard for Human Life
by Ramesh Ponnuru
Regnery Publishing, 2006
(320 pages, $27.95, hardcover)

reviewed by Jennifer Roback Morse

The mainstream media do not look very good in Ramesh Ponnuru’s account: They look more like cooperative lapdogs for the abortion lobby than objective reporters of truth. The overwhelming theme of The Party of Death, written by a senior editor of National Review, is that sustaining the Party of Death has required a massive amount of denial and outright fraud about abortion and its impact on society.
